I've been doing a lot of old-time-radio (OTR) listening over the holidays, something I mentioned before [0] and have continued to enjoy over the years. Archive.org has a huge (and growing) collection [1] if you have an interest in sampling the shows. Some of the best series include Gunsmoke, Escape, Lights Out, CBS Radio Mystery Theater (CBSRMT) [2], X Minus One, and Nightfall. A recent fun episode I listened to was 'Olive Darling and Morton Dear', a CBSRMT episode from 1977 featuring the voice of Fred Gwynne (the same Fred Gwynne of Munsters fame). He was in over 80 of the CBSRMT episodes [3] and apart from being an excellent actor, has one of those perfect radio voices. You can stream or download the episode on Archive.org [4].
